Blue wave view apartment, a property with a terrace, is located in Opatija, 14 km from HNK Rijeka Stadium Rujevica, 17 km from The Maritime and History Museum of the Croatian Littoral, as well as 18 km from The Croatian National Theatre Ivan Zajc. Guests staying at this apartment have access to free WiFi, a fully equipped kitchen, and a balcony. The property is non-smoking and isless than 1 km from Slatina Beach.
This 1-bedroom apartment will provide you with a flat-screen TV, air conditioning and a living room.
Trsat Castle is 20 km from the apartment, while Pazin Castle is 47 km from the property. Rijeka Airport is 42 km away.
